  1. Click ‘Get Form’ to open the rockdale water application in the editor.
  2. Begin by entering your customer name and wait for your customer number to be assigned by RWR.
  3. Specify the start service date and provide both the complete service address and billing address.
  4. Indicate if this is a transfer of service by selecting 'Yes' or 'No'. If 'Yes', include your previous address.
  5. Choose whether to leave the service on at the previous location or request disconnection, specifying the disconnection date if applicable.
  6. Fill in your home and work telephone numbers, social security/tax ID number, driver's license number, and date of birth.
  7. Provide your employer's name and address, then select your status as owner, renter, or management company.
  8. Review the agreement section carefully before signing and dating the form to acknowledge compliance with RWR ordinances.

Most groundwater in Georgia used for agriculture is drawn from the Floridan aquifer (the blue section in the Southern portion of the state). This is a limestone aquifer that has a high transmissivity and water is available in large quantities.
A former Republican stronghold, Rockdale County has undergone a massive shift towards the Democratic Party in recent decades, primarily due to large growth of the African-American population.
Big Haynes Creek is the raw drinking water source for Rockdale County.
Rockdale County drinking water is sourced from surface water with an intake in Big Haynes Creek, part of the Ocmulgee River watershed.
Rockdale County is located 24 miles east of Atlanta on Interstate I-20. It is approximately 132 square miles in sizethe second smallest of Georgias 159 countiesand has a population estimated by the Atlanta Regional Commission of 90,000.
